This is how it works: • The Children's Centre manager identifies relevant agencies already dealing with vulnerable families — for example schools, health visitors or a local homeless families unit • A simple form summarising the facilities and activities available at the Centre, and asking for a parent's contact details and a signature, is created • The manager / staff at the other agency agree, as part of their usual data recording protocols, to ask relevant service users to fill in the form.
Engaging with fathers in vulnerable families is one of the toughest nuts Children's Centres must crack.
The «Consent to Contact» scheme, developed by the Wellington and Meredith Children's Centres in Ipswich, involves reaching out to vulnerable families by «piggybacking» onto the work of other agencies.
